High-performance three-phase reciprocating compressors like the Danfoss KCM514CAL are made for commercial air conditioning and refrigeration applications. It is compatible with a variety of cooling systems since it runs on a frequency of 50 Hz and a voltage range of 180-260V. This compressor offers effective cooling performance while preserving energy efficiency because it is tuned for R404A refrigerant. It provides dependable operation up to 55°C in high ambient temperatures with a power input of 1840W and a current consumption of 8.7A. Long-term durability and improved startup performance are guaranteed by the CSCR motor technology. An internal motor protector included inside the compressor protects against overload by switching off all three phases at once. To improve system performance and stop refrigerant migration, a PTC crankcase heater is advised.
